Introduction to Peripheral Intravenous Cannulation (IPIC-Online) - Courses - Central (csds.qld.edu.au)
Course description 
This ONLINE learning course provides the fundamental knowledge required for Peripheral Intravenous Cannulation (PIVC) in an adult. The course covers the underpinning theory including preparation, the aseptic approach and insertion technique.
The online learning component has been designed to be complimented with a face-to-face workshop focusing on the practical skills needed to safely perform PIVC. Completing the online learning alone will not enable transition to clinical practice.
